St Mary the Virgin Church at Great Milton has just established its own localised Wi-Fi network. It is the first religious building in Oxfordshire to have an Info Point installed.
The Info Point enables anyone with a mobile phone to view an 11-point interactive tour of the Grade I historic building and its unique features. The church tour includes information on the significant 17th century Dormer Monument and an unusual church organ that is placed in the vicar’s stall.

Plans to add a children’s quiz are also in the pipeline. St Mary’s gets an exceptional number of overseas visitors for a small village church because of its immediate proximity to Le Manoir aux Quat’Saisons hotel.
